   15个例句给GRE写作提分。新GRE写作要求考生在30分钟+30分钟内分别完成两篇文章,难度不小。要想快速提高作文含金量,背一些新GRE写作经典句型是最为快速的方法了。下面是小编整理的15个例句给GRE写作提分 :


  新GRE作文提分的例句:
  1、超越性的题目:
  现实与理想;眼前利益与长期利益;集体身份与人格独立;规约与自由,利己与利他、竞争与合作、客观束缚与主观能动人类之所以纠结,在于沉重的肉身和高傲的灵魂之间不可调和的矛盾。人若是卑微,总是世俗的纷扰让我们难以自拔;人若是高尚,只是因为心中的理想。我们是魔鬼的孩子,却长着天使的翅膀。
  A man suffers from inescapable pain, a torturing split between the sunken flesh and the arrogant 1 soul. So sunken the flesh is that a man indulges himself into lust 2, sloth 3, greed and hatred 4, so arrogant the soul is that he never abandons his rights of morality, religion, passion and freedom. A man is never a demon 5, nor is he an angel.
  2、虚无性的题目:
  知识、科技、实践、经验、批判思维、历史的真伪、文化存在的本质为人对所存在事物的感知,故而世界的本质便是虚无。
  The existence only exists in people's perception, which, by nature, is of vanity.
  3、时间性题目:
  传统与创新、历史是否可以被借鉴、科技与人文、进步时间对于个体来说是线性而不可逆转的;而对于整个宇宙,无非是一个周而复始的圆圈。
  Time for individuals is consecutive 6 and irreversible, but for the universe, just a repetitive circle.
  4、政府与人民
  人民除了权利,什么都没有,甚至没有使用权利的基本能力。因而他们选举了一个叫做政府的机构。
  Citizens, apart from claiming to have rights, in fact, have no capability 7 to exercise their rights. Therefore, they select a government.
  5、个体与集体、身份、领导者与大众
  他人给了你身份,故而,他们就是你的地狱。
  Others bestow 8 you an identity, and thus, they are the hell.
